> Reuters
>
> 3:40pm 6.Jul.98.PDT WASHINGTON -- A district court has
>dismissed a law
> professor's challenge to US regulations strictly
limiting the
>export of
> computer data-scrambling technology.
>
> Judge James Gwin ruled late Friday that the export
limits, which
>prevented
> Case Western Reserve University Law School professor
Peter
>Junger from
> posting the text of encryption programs on the Internet,
did not
>violate
> the constitutional right to free speech.
>
> The Ohio court's ruling contradicts a California
district court
>ruling last
> August that said source code -- the instructions a
person writes
>telling
> the computer what actions to perform -- constitutes a
form of
>speech
> subject to First Amendment protection.
>
> "Unlike instructions, a manual or a recipe, source code
actually
>performs
> the function it describes," Gwin wrote. "While a recipe
provides
> instructions to a cook, source code is a device, like
embedded
>circuitry in
> a telephone, that actually does the function of
encryption."
>
> Neither ruling gave speech protection to compiled code,
a
>version of source
> code converted into an actual software program that
could be run
>on a
> computer.
>
> The US government appealed the California decision and
the issue
>may
> ultimately be decided by the Supreme Court.
>
> Civil libertarians and high-tech companies had hoped the
court
>would
> overturn the export limits on encryption technology,
which uses
> mathematical formulas to scramble information and render
it
>unreadable
> without a password or software "key."
>
> Once the realm of spies and generals, encryption has
become an
>increasingly
> critical means of protecting electronic commerce and
global
>communications
> over the Internet.
>
> But law enforcement agencies, fearing encryption will be
used by
>terrorists
> and international criminals to hide their activities,
have
>instituted
> strict controls to limit the export of strong scrambling
>products.
>
> Lawyers opposed to the export rules said the Ohio court
>misunderstood the
> difference between source code and compiled code.
>
> "The Ohio court clearly doesn't understand the
communicative
>nature of
> software," said Shari Steele, an attorney with the
Electronic
>Frontier
> Foundation. "It's true that software helps to perform
functions,
>but it
> does so by telling computers what to do.... It certainly
is
>speech
> deserving of the highest levels of First Amendment
protection."

Obviously there is no difference between 10 lines of PERL and
1500 lines of assembler (or machine code). Executability is in the
eye of the beholder. I can create an interpreter to execute english
(and in fact have done so in LISP). Does that mean english is no longer
protected?
By the same argument, DNA is also a device. The federal government
can now determine who you can reproduce with. (eugenics?)
DNA strands are instructions, code if you will, that describe to
cellular automata (literally ;-), how to (1) create a human being
(that could be dangerous -- they've been known to kill) and
(2) through fantastic complexity generate a fully functioning
human being, with all the behavioral patterns and biological
operations necessary to sustain said human being.
Imputing "deviceness" to code is missing the point. There is
"deviceness" in all information. It just depends on the context.
I would argue that it is specifically this "deviceness" that is protected
in the first amendment. Speech isn't just about yammering on about
abstract concepts. The imperative form of speech is probably the
most necessary to protect in a free society.
The most sacred form of democratic speech is probably the
vote. Does it contain "deviceness"? Absolutely. The vote
is democratic force.
Is it not protected speech?
Speech in action is code in action. When they can make code
illegal, they can make comittees to un-elect illegal and they
can make talking about impeaching the president illegal.
Think about that.

One of Peter Junger's examples (I think used in the case) is the RSA
in 2/3 lines. He actually obtained the US export administrations
written decisions on which of a small collection of titchy programs
was exportable. RSA in 3 lines of perl they stated was illegal to
export.
So fun things with RSA are possible because they have decided that it
is not exportable, so perhaps you could export it on a floppy, or as
your .signature, with media cameras rolling, and try to get yourself
arrested for willful violation of dumb export laws.
